Dancing the Night Away at Dumbarton House {Janelle + Matt}






Back in October, I shared some really special engagement photos taken by the very talented Linda Crayton of a very special couple, Janelle and Matt.  I now have the pleasure of sharing that same couple’s incredible wedding photos shot again by LindaCrayton




The bride and her bridesmaids spent the morning with makeup artist, Kim Giammaria of Beauty Mark and hairstylist Giselle of Hair by Giselle before heading over to St Peter’s Catholic Church on Capitol Hill for the very emotional wedding ceremony. 



After the ceremony, the bride and groom took photos while guests made their way to the very beautiful Dumbarton House, located in Georgetown, for an outdoor cocktail hour on the lawn and patio and seated dinner in the downstairs ballroom.   The guests were greeted by the sounds of the Winn Brothers band playing.  To help keep the guests cool on this warm Saturday in June, the bride and groom had the bartenders mix up a spiked lemonade as their specialty drink. 








Each of the guests had an opportunity to leave their mark on the wedding by placing their finger in ink (matching the colors of the wedding, blue and orange) and placing it on a photo of a tree where, once done, all of the fingerprints looked like the leaves of the tree. 

 

Once cocktails were over, guests were ushered downstairs where they dined on a delicious menu created by Design Cuisine Caterers.  The bride used mini chalkboards with an unfinished white wood finish to display the menu on each table.  White paper lanterns were hung around the tent that was just outside the ballroom and created a great ambiance as the night settled in. 




After the guests filled up on sweet potato french fries, steaks and crabcakes, The WinnBrothers picked up where they left off and kept the Bride and Groom (and the rest of their guests) on the dancefloor until the very last song.   I owe the bride a very big thank you for dragging me out to dance with her and the groom for "Come On Eileen."





A unique and delicious wedding cake and groom’s cake was designed by the DC’s own, MaggieAustin Cakes.  The fresh blackberries with vanilla icing was absolutely amazing!

Sara & Nelson {Hot Style at DAR}



Sara and Nelson turned a hot day into a smoking celebration back in early June.  The couple married at St. Bernadette's in Springfield and then danced into the evening on the portico at DAR.


The color pallet, look and feel of their wedding reminded me of Miami meets DC with the stately looking venue.  The columns around the portico are frequently used in movies as a stand in for the White House as the facades look so similar.




As guests arrives for cocktail hour the humidity was hitting it's peak for the day and guests couldn't decide if a small shower would be a good or bad thing.  But per the luck of my beautiful bride, while inside the O'Byrne gallery for dinner, the wind changed and took the humidity with it while barely a raindrop fell.
